Is it Possible to Reverse the Direction of a Worm Gearbox?
Yes, it is possible to reverse the direction of a worm gearbox by changing the orientation of either the input or output shaft. However, reversing the direction of a worm gearbox can have some implications that need to be considered:
- Efficiency: Reversing the direction of a worm gearbox can potentially affect its efficiency. Worm gearboxes are typically more efficient in one direction of rotation due to the design of the worm and worm wheel.
- Backlash: Reversing the direction of rotation might lead to increased backlash or play in the gearbox, which can impact precision and smooth operation.
- Lubrication: Depending on the gearbox’s design, reversing the direction could affect lubrication distribution and lead to uneven wear on the gear teeth.
- Load: Reversing the direction might also impact the gearbox’s load-carrying capacity, especially if it’s designed for predominantly one-way operation.
- Noise and Vibration: Direction reversal can sometimes result in increased noise and vibration due to changes in gear engagement and meshing behavior.
If you need to reverse the direction of a worm gearbox, it’s advisable to consult the gearbox manufacturer’s guidelines and recommendations. They can provide insights into whether the specific gearbox model is suitable for reversible operation and any precautions or adjustments needed to ensure proper functioning.
Does a Worm Reducer Require Frequent Maintenance?
Worm reducers generally require less frequent maintenance compared to some other types of gearboxes due to their design and operating characteristics. However, maintenance is still essential to ensure optimal performance and longevity. Here are some key points to consider:
- Lubrication: Proper lubrication is crucial for worm gearboxes. Regularly check the lubricant level and quality to prevent wear and overheating. Lubricant should be changed as recommended by the manufacturer.
- Inspections: Periodically inspect the gearbox for signs of wear, damage, or oil leaks. Check for any unusual noises, vibrations, or changes in performance that could indicate a problem.
- Tightening and Alignment: Check and tighten any loose fasteners and ensure that the gearbox is properly aligned. Misalignment can lead to increased wear and reduced efficiency.
- Seal Maintenance: Inspect and maintain seals to prevent oil leakage and contaminants from entering the gearbox.
- Cleaning: Keep the gearbox clean from debris and contaminants that could affect its performance. Regular cleaning can prevent premature wear and damage.
- Load and Speed: Ensure that the gearbox is operating within its rated load and speed limits. Exceeding these limits can lead to accelerated wear and potential failure.
- Environmental Conditions: Consider the operating environment of the gearbox. Extreme temperatures, humidity, and other factors can impact the gearbox’s performance and longevity.
While worm gearboxes are known for their durability and self-locking feature, neglecting maintenance can lead to premature wear, reduced efficiency, and potential breakdowns. Following the manufacturer’s recommendations for maintenance intervals and procedures is essential to keep the worm reducer in optimal condition.
Lubrication Requirements for a Worm Gearbox
Lubrication is crucial for maintaining the performance and longevity of a worm gearbox. Here are the key considerations for lubricating a worm gearbox:
- Type of Lubricant: Use a high-quality, high-viscosity lubricant specifically designed for worm gearboxes. Worm gearboxes require lubricants with additives that provide proper lubrication and prevent wear.
- Lubrication Interval: Follow the manufacturer’s recommendations for lubrication intervals. Regularly check the gearbox’s temperature and oil condition to determine the optimal frequency of lubrication.
- Oil Level: Maintain the proper oil level to ensure effective lubrication. Too little oil can lead to insufficient lubrication, while too much oil can cause overheating and foaming.
- Lubrication Points: Identify all the lubrication points on the gearbox, including the worm and wheel gear surfaces. Apply the lubricant evenly to ensure complete coverage.
- Temperature: Consider the operating temperature of the gearbox. Some lubricants have temperature limits, and extreme temperatures can affect lubricant viscosity and performance.
- Cleanliness: Keep the gearbox and the surrounding area clean to prevent contaminants from entering the lubricant. Use proper filtration and seals to maintain a clean environment.
- Monitoring: Regularly monitor the gearbox’s temperature, noise level, and vibration to detect any signs of inadequate lubrication or other issues.
Proper lubrication will reduce friction, wear, and heat generation, ensuring smooth and efficient operation of the worm gearbox. Always refer to the manufacturer’s guidelines for lubrication specifications and intervals.
